Start off your upgraded beach wave style by protecting your strands from any potential damage. We suggest Bed Head by TIGI Beach Bound Protection Spray to guard your hair from the sun and salt water and a day spent exposing your hair to the elements. Next up, you’ll want to recreate the texture that you’re left with after hours in the salty ocean air. Suave Professionals Sea Mineral Infusion Texturizing Sea Salt Spray is what we like to think of as the beach in a bottle. Generously spritz this product into your damp strands and then leave your hair to air dry. That means no scrunching, teasing, touching or winding strands around your finger. Let your hair take the lead and allow the salt spray to work its magic. Stash a bottle of TRESemmé Compressed Micro Mist Hairspray Texture Hold Level 1 in your bag to spray on your strands once your waves dry. This hairspray will lock in the style and add a touch of texture. Another bonus is that the bottle is thin and narrow and will barely take up any space in your bag.
